Build or Rebuild Your Credit

The bad news is that some of us have poor credit or not enough credit; therefore our score is stagnant. The good news is there are ways to help us build or rebuild our credit.

Below is four ways to add positive tradelines to your credit report. This is perfect for those who are working on repairing their credit and for those who need a boost in their credit score.

1. Apply for a secured credit card

If you apply and get approved for a secured credit card and use it responsibly, you can watch your score increase while you work to get rid of the negatives. All of the major credit card issuers offer them. Stay away from subprime card issuers as most have no grace period on interest and monthly fees. Do your research!  Read the terms of all credit card offers. Discover, Capital one, Open Sky, etc. are just some examples of card issuers that offer secured credit cards. You will be required to pay a deposit. It’s worth it!

 2. Become an Authorized User

Let’s say your parents, spouse, or sibling has good credit. They are trustworthy and manage their credit cards well. Ask to be added to their credit card as an authorized user. Just don’t get a copy of the card. You’ll immediately see a FICO score increase. All of their good history with that card is added to your report without a hard inquiry. The best part is that none of your negative credit history will be added to theirs. Bonus, you can request removal at any time since you are not legally responsible for the charges.

3. Sign up for Self lender

Self lender offers a small loan that is held in a Certificate of Deposit (CD). You are essentially building credit while you save and earn interest. You choose the dollar amount you want to save each month and the terms (12 months). Every time you make a payment, you receive a good mark on your credit report. Double benefit: you are saving & boosting your score. The only drawback is if you miss a payment it will look like you’re late on a loan. So don’t miss a payment! You’re paying yourself remember?

4. Try the Shopping Cart Trick (SCT)

You can apply for certain store credit cards issued by Comenity Bank without a hard inquiry. Here, you’d add an item to your shopping cart, and at check out you’ll be asked if you want to apply for their card (preapproval pop-up). The trick is when you get the preapproval pop-up, enter only the last 4 digits of your social security number like this: 000-00-1234. However, clicking the APPLY button on the website will result in a hard inquiry even if you enter the last 4 digits of your social security number. Some people have reported getting a hard inquiry even when they receive the pop-up, but most people do not.  For a full list of store cards obtainable via the Shopping Cart Trick, join our FB group.

Unfortunately, SCT may not won’t work for everyone, but here are some tips you can try:

  • Turn off your pop up blockers.
  • Review your credit report for old addresses and try each one.
  • Opt-in to pre-approval offers.
